Our performance is a comedy, based on situations and stories typical of relationships. What do a man and a woman do to each other when one wants something different from the other? Is there a good way to divide the housework? Can grandmothers raise children differently from parents? What if the man wants an open marriage? The aim of the performance is to provide participants with a complex community theatre experience in which they have the opportunity to look at, reflect on and think about their own relationship patterns, problems and life situations - and to laugh together. The life situations under examination are viewed from a distance, helped by the humour and playfulness of the performance.

Our performance is interactive, giving the audience the opportunity to express their thoughts and insights about the scenes, and at one point they even have the chance to "instruct" the actors in a particular scene, and based on their suggestions, the actors will re-enact the scene. However, this is entirely voluntary!

KuglerArt Szalon Gallery and Shop

CONTEMPORARY ROMA ART COLLECTION FOR ROMA ARTISTS

The aim of our gallery is to present and support Roma art, folk art and crafts together.

Gypsy art was born in our time and continues to evolve today. Today, more than fifty artists who identify themselves as Gypsies or Roma are represented in Hungarian museums and exhibition halls. In her newly created private gallery, filmmaker Edit Kőszegi can see and buy the best works of these artists. A selection of the paintings on display has been shown at the Hungarian National Gallery, the Museum of Ethnography, in Beijing, in New York and Paris under the auspices of UNESCO, and most recently in Passau and Stockholm.

We also collect material relics of Roma folk culture. In addition to authentic Roma folk art objects, the Gallery's collection also includes works of applied art, both traditional and modern.

Music and ethnographic films, books and albums on the theme enrich the offer.

As a salon, the Gallery offers a variety of programmes for young artists in different artistic disciplines.

The Gallery is located in the centre of Budapest, in an imposing apartment next to Deák Ferenc Square.
